For sale is one almost unused, nearly new in box SimpleShare NAS (Network Attached Storage) device with 250GB. This was a warranty replacement that I got a few months ago from SimpleTech. Comes in the original packaging. Was used (turned on) for about one month.

Features include:
Store and share files over a network
Easy setup with AutoDiscovery (no network experience required)
Backup and protect PC or Mac files with Retrospect Express Expand storage capacity with additional USB drives
Share printers over a network with built-in USB print server
Fast Ethernet 10/100 LAN connection
NASFinder software provides automatic drive mapping and simple configuration
Compact, space-saving design, quiet fan-free design
FREE unlimited technical support, boxes says 3yr warranty

Manuf info page is here

Has worked great - have used it with user-level password security on the shared folders - can also use share-level security. Uses CIF for Macs and Windows, NFS for Unix/Solaris access (it uses some form of embedded Linux internally). You can also encrypt a storage pool for extra data security. Uses a web-based interface to administer. Have not tried the print server function. Nor have I installed the Retrospect Express that comes with it.
